[利用放射性同位素对牙釉质再矿化的研究]

[Studies on the remineralization of enamel using radioisotopes].

作者信息

Magas S, Górski Z, Mendyk W, Kostański M

出版信息

Czas Stomatol. 1990 May;43(5):249-54.

PMID:2104352
Abstract

Enamel of human and bovine teeth was found to show sorption of free calcium ions after damage caused by short-term exposure to diluted hydrochloric acid or mechanical damage. The experiment was carried out using radioisotopes 32P and 45Ca and it was shown that majority of incorporated ions remained in the enamel after prolonged washing out with water as well as after brushing with toothpaste. A considerable stability of binding of the incorporated phosphate ions was noted in the damaged enamel after exposure to calcium salt solution, and marked stability of binding of the incorporated calcium ions after exposure to phosphate solution.
